Step-by-Step Guide: How to Use Your Hoppe's BoreSnake Viper Den for Optimal Results
Using the Hoppe's BoreSnake Viper Den is incredibly straightforward, but a few best practices will ensure you get the most out of every cleaning session.
- Ensure Firearm Safety: Always, always confirm your firearm is unloaded, the action is open, and the chamber is clear before beginning any cleaning procedure. Remove the magazine.
- Apply Solvent (Optional but Recommended): While the BoreSnake can be used dry for quick passes, applying a small amount of Hoppe's No. 9 Gun Bore Cleaner or a similar solvent to the bronze brush section and the initial part of the BoreSnake's tail will significantly enhance its cleaning power, helping to break down stubborn carbon and copper fouling.
- Insert the Pull Cord: From the chamber end of the barrel, drop the brass weight attached to the pull cord down the barrel. Gravity will guide it through the bore until it exits the muzzle.
- Attach and Pull: Once the weight is out, grasp the cord and pull it through until you can reach the BoreSnake itself. Attach the included T-handle to the loop on the pull cord for a secure grip.
- Smoothly Pull Through: With a firm, steady motion, pull the BoreSnake completely through the barrel from the chamber end to the muzzle. Do not pull it back and forth; a single, continuous pull is designed for optimal cleaning. You should feel slight resistance as the brush and tail do their work.
- Inspect and Repeat (If Necessary): After the first pass, inspect your bore. For routine cleaning, one pass is often sufficient. For heavily fouled barrels, you might perform a second pass.
- Apply Lubricant (Optional): If you plan to store the firearm, apply a thin layer of a high-quality gun oil or lubricant to the bore by applying a few drops to the BoreSnake before a final pass, or by using a separate oil-soaked patch.
- Store Your BoreSnake: After use, you can rinse your BoreSnake with warm soapy water and air dry it. Once dry, neatly coil it and place it back into its compact Viper Den case for organized storage.
Optimal Rifle Maintenance: Beyond the Quick Clean
While the Hoppe's BoreSnake Viper Den is a game-changer for fast and effective bore cleaning, it's also part of a broader strategy for comprehensive firearm care.
- Understanding Fouling: Rifles like the AR-15, which fire high-velocity rounds such as .223 Remington or 5.56x45mm NATO, generate significant carbon fouling from burning powder, and sometimes copper fouling from bullet jackets. The BoreSnake excels at removing carbon, which is the most common and immediate concern for accuracy degradation.
- When to Deep Clean: For extremely high round counts or for removing stubborn copper fouling that builds up over time, a more intensive cleaning regimen involving specialized copper solvents and traditional jags and patches may occasionally be necessary. However, the BoreSnake significantly extends the time between these more involved cleaning sessions.
- Frequency of Cleaning: How often should you clean your rifle? For optimal performance, a quick pass with the BoreSnake after every range trip or hunting outing is highly recommended. This prevents fouling from hardening and becoming more difficult to remove, contributing to consistent accuracy and prolonging barrel life.
